    Reinstall OS X if you've never done this before:
    How to Perform an Archive and Install
    An Archive and Install will NOT erase your hard drive, but you must have sufficient free space for a second OS X installation which could be from 3-9 GBs depending upon the version of OS X and selected installation options. The free space requirement is over and above normal free space requirements which should be at least 6-10 GBs. Read all the linked references carefully before proceeding.
    1. Be sure to use Disk Utility first to repair the disk before performing the Archive and Install.
    Repairing the Hard Drive and Permissions
    Boot from your OS X Installer disc. After the installer loads select your language and click on the Continue button. When the menu bar appears select Disk Utility from the Installer menu (Utilities menu for Tiger, Leopard or Snow Leopard.) After DU loads select your hard drive entry (mfgr.'s ID and drive size) from the the left side list. In the DU status area you will see an entry for the S.M.A.R.T. status of the hard drive. If it does not say "Verified" then the hard drive is failing or failed. (SMART status is not reported on external Firewire or USB drives.) If the drive is "Verified" then select your OS X volume from the list on the left (sub-entry below the drive entry,) click on the First Aid tab, then click on the Repair Disk button. If DU reports any errors that have been fixed, then re-run Repair Disk until no errors are reported. If no errors are reported click on the Repair Permissions button. Wait until the operation completes, then quit DU and return to the installer. Now restart normally.
    If DU reports errors it cannot fix, then you will need Disk Warrior and/or Tech Tool Pro to repair the drive. If you don't have either of them or if neither of them can fix the drive, then you will need to reformat the drive and reinstall OS X.
    2. Do not proceed with an Archive and Install if DU reports errors it cannot fix. In that case use Disk Warrior and/or TechTool Pro to repair the hard drive. If neither can repair the drive, then you will have to erase the drive and reinstall from scratch.
    3. Boot from your OS X Installer disc. After the installer loads select your language and click on the Continue button. When you reach the screen to select a destination drive click once on the destination drive then click on the Option button. Select the Archive and Install option. You have an option to preserve users and network preferences. Only select this option if you are sure you have no corrupted files in your user accounts. Otherwise leave this option unchecked. Click on the OK button and continue with the OS X Installation.
    4. Upon completion of the Archive and Install you will have a Previous System Folder in the root directory. You should retain the PSF until you are sure you do not need to manually transfer any items from the PSF to your newly installed system.
    5. After moving any items you want to keep from the PSF you should delete it. You can back it up if you prefer, but you must delete it from the hard drive.
    6. You can now download a Combo Updater directly from Apple's download site to update your new system to the desired version as well as install any security or other updates. You can also do this using Software Update.
    An even better choice is to wipe the drive and reinstall Leopard from scratch. Make a backup first, then restore your files from the backup.

    One possible solution would be to organise your inbox into folders.
    Its never relly good on any system to have one folder that has everything in it.
    Try going to you web gui for that mail account and organise your folders and move mails from your inbox into corresponding folders for better organisation.
    Several folders containing the same amount of one folder will usually load a little quicker as the folder may not be accessed to download its content unless veiwed.
    So having 10 folders with organised content, and you inbox as an area thats to hold only new emails would work much much quicker with imap.
    Most imap servers will only update the contents of a folder when its veiwed.

    I had a look at the DCM query performance in PH1 system and figured out
    that most of the time is spent at the LIME layer of database. The
    following LIME tables are having far too many entries and is causing
    the bottleneck during the query execution.
    /LIME/NLOG_QUAN - 38,165,467
    /LIME/PN_ITEM - 19,116,518
    /LIME/PN_ITEM_TB - 19,154,124
    These tables are storing the historical information about LIME(stock)
    updates. Since these table grow with each change/update of stock
    information, it will slow down the performance of the system over a
    period of time. And to avoid the slow responses, the tables should
    ideally be archived on a periodic basis to keep the data volume as
    minimal as possible. You may have to discuss with the Business to
    determine the number of days of LIME record you would want to retain
    in the system. I would strongly recommend you to consider the LIME
    archival retaining the minimum days (<=60 days) of historical
    information. You can find more information about the Lime Archival
    in the Sap Help link:
    http://help.sap.com/saphelp_scm2007/helpdata/en/44/2a83121dde23d1e10000000a1553f7/frameset.htm.
    Kindly get in touch with your BASIS consultant for the LIME archival.
    The application performance should definitely improve after the LIME
